GP France 2024, Qualifying: Héctor Garzó wins his first pole in the category

It is also the first pole for the Spanish rider in the MotoGP, with Spinelli and Granado completing the front row of the two MotoE races.


The first qualifications this Le Mans weekend have already been put to rest, namely those of the MotoE class. The 100% electric MotoGP series faced its two ten-minute rounds and, in the end, it was Héctor Garzó who achieved the decisive fastest lap.

The Spaniard, second in the general classification after Portugal, printed a time of 1:39.995, as the only driver under 1:40. In this way, the standard bearer of the Intact GP Dynavolt team won his first pole in the category and in the world championship Circus.

Qualifying was quite close and, in the end, Garzó took the lead by just 0.031 over second-placed Nicholas Spinelli. Completing the front row will be Eric Granado, on the first of the two Ducati V21L team LCR.

Mattia Casadei, after being excluded from direct access to Q2, managed to make amends by moving from Q1 and finishing fourth, ahead of Óscar Gutiérrez and Jordi Torres. In the third row we will find, for the two heats, Alessandro Zaccone, Miquel Pons and Lukas Tulovic (in this order from seventh to ninth place).

The one who chews bitterly today is Matteo Ferrari: the former 2019 world champion started from pole here last year, however in 2024 the #11 will be forced to start from 14th (and two positions further back than Alessio Finelli, his boxing partner ), a sign of a season that shows no signs of getting going for the Rimini native.
